Yingsong Lin
About
Yingsong Lin has authored 120 papers that have received a total of 4.3k indexed citations.
This includes 43 papers in Surgery, 43 papers in Oncology and 25 papers in Epidemiology. The topics of these papers are Helicobacter pylori-related gastroenterology studies (26 papers), Cancer Risks and Factors (19 papers) and Pancreatic and Hepatic Oncology Research (17 papers). Yingsong Lin is often cited by papers focused on Helicobacter pylori-related gastroenterology studies (26 papers), Cancer Risks and Factors (19 papers) and Pancreatic and Hepatic Oncology Research (17 papers) and collaborates with scholars based in Japan, India and United States. Yingsong Lin's co-authors include Akiko Tamakoshi, Shogo Kikuchi, Kiyoko Yagyu, Kenji Wakai and Yoshiyuki Ohno and has published in prestigious journals such as Journal of Clinical Oncology, Scientific Reports and International Journal of Cancer.
